A Guide to Mastering Rocket Jumping with the Soldier in TF2
Por kyle1.ca
Rocket jumping is a unique and essential skill in Team Fortress 2, particularly for the Soldier class. It allows you to reach strategic positions quickly, evade danger, and surprise your enemies. This guide will help you master the art of rocket jumping as a Soldier.

11 Simple Steps
1. Choose the Right Loadout:

Start by selecting the appropriate loadout. Equip a rocket launcher, such as the Original or the stock Rocket Launcher, and consider using the Gunboats secondary weapon to reduce self-damage during jumps.

2. Basic Rocket Jumping Technique:

To perform a basic rocket jump, aim at your feet and crouch. As you fire a rocket, jump simultaneously. The explosion's force will propel you into the air.
Practice this technique to understand the basics of rocket jumping.

3. Advanced Rocket Jumping:

Mastering rocket jumping involves various advanced techniques. These include:
a. Wall Jumps: Aim at a wall, crouch, and fire a rocket. The explosion will push you away from the wall, allowing you to reach higher platforms.

b. Pogo Jumps: To maintain continuous height and mobility, perform pogo jumps. Fire a rocket beneath your feet while in mid-air to stay airborne.

c. Sync Jumps: Sync jumps involve firing two rockets in quick succession. The first rocket propels you, and the second maintains your momentum. Sync jumps are crucial for covering long distances.

4. Map Exploration and Practice:

To master rocket jumping, explore jump maps created by the TF2 community. These maps are designed specifically for practicing rocket jumps.
Visit jump servers or search for jump maps in the server browser.

5. Learn Rollouts:

Rollouts are rocket jump routes used to quickly reach objectives or critical map points. Understanding rollouts can give your team an edge in competitive play.
Watch videos or read guides on specific map rollouts to maximize your effectiveness.

6. Watch and Learn:

Observe skilled players and jump map experts to learn advanced techniques, shortcuts, and efficient jump routes.
Many TF2 content creators offer tutorials and gameplay footage demonstrating rocket jumping skills.

7. Self-Damage Management:

Rocket jumping inflicts self-damage. Use the Gunboats to reduce self-damage, but keep an eye on your health. Pick up health packs or stay near your Medic for healing.

8. Practice Precision:

Precision is key for rocket jumping. Experiment with various angles, timings, and jump heights to control your jumps and reach specific locations.
The more precise you become, the more versatile you'll be as a Soldier.

9. Balance Risk and Reward:

Rocket jumping carries inherent risks, as it reduces your health and may leave you vulnerable. Assess whether a jump is worth the potential danger.
Avoid overextending when jumping and consider retreating when necessary.

10. Experiment with Different Maps:

Rocket jumping isn't limited to jump maps. Experiment with rocket jumps on standard maps to gain a tactical advantage or surprise your enemies.

11. Communicate with Your Team:

In team-based game modes, communicate with your team about your jump intentions. Inform them of your positions and plans for coordinated attacks.
